First, the status quo electronic waste pollution

    As electronic products updating speed, the e-waste generated faster speed. The United States is the world's largest producer of electronic products and the manufacture of electronic waste, e-waste generated each year of 7-8 million tons, and is becoming more and more of the next few years just to eliminate the old on the computer about 3 million units. Europe as a whole the volume of e-waste generated is about 6 million tons / year, of which Germany each year to produce 1.8 million tons of electronic waste, France is 1.5 million tons. 
    And in the country, with the rapid development of high-tech industries and the people's living standards rapidly improved, office, living in the use of computers, mobile phones, printers, and other electronic products to increase at an alarming rate. They scrapped after the e-waste poses a serious environmental pollution. 
    According to statistics, in 1991 China's mobile phone users to 1 million, in 2001 to more than 100 million, is expected in 2008 will reach 500 million. To the use of mobile phones on average every three years, China will be spent each year there are 70 million mobile phone number, plus phone annex and battery, the e-waste generated in about 400,000 tons. TV, washing machines, refrigerators, computers, and every year in the elimination of more than 20 million units, of which more than 400 million TV sets, washing machines more than 500 million units, refrigerators more than 500 million units, more than 600 million computers. 
  

Second, e-waste hazards

    Electronic improper waste disposal, a very big impact on the environment. 
    Waste electronic products and general MSW were very different: chassis plastic and circuit board containing brominated flame retardants; monitors, tubes and printed circuit boards, containing lead; circuit board solder pewter; semiconductors, circuit boards and batteries containing cadmium and iron chassis, disk drives containing chromium; switches, disk drives and sensors contain mercury; batteries containing nickel, lithium, cadmium and other metals; wire and packaging materials containing poly vinyl chloride, and so on. 
    E-waste in these substances are harmful. If the waste disposed of electronic products to the wilderness or no treatment landfill in the soil, will be the lead contained by the infiltration of soil and groundwater pollution. If these goods Waste incineration, and will release a large number of harmful gases, air pollution.
